Output 7593ad13dfc704be80dc59a3fccc56c1f19bd4816587eb71db8dd90e8ad5a0ce:51

value
1595186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9da8ed4d0fb7fe13bc2a34169f6419080a8e600e OP_EQUAL
address
3G4eNuqoxKJZ7yw4HmAgqZugJQMpwfXrT7
transaction
7593ad13dfc704be80dc59a3fccc56c1f19bd4816587eb71db8dd90e8ad5a0ce